Benefits of Bindweed Removal

Why Remove Bindweed?

Bindweed is a highly invasive perennial that can choke out native plants, cause structural damage to buildings and trees, and even harm wildlife. Removing it not only restores the aesthetic appeal of your garden but also protects the environment and your property value.
